This Afghan Baluchi rug displays a captivating array of colors woven into traditional geometric motifs across its rich field. Deep burgundy and navy blues form the foundation, accented by warm terracotta and ivory highlights that create depth and visual interest. The intricate border work features repeating diamond and star patterns that frame the central design beautifully. The overall effect is both sophisticated and welcoming, with colors that have mellowed into perfect harmony.
Handcrafted by skilled Afghan weavers using time-honored techniques passed down through generations, this rug represents the authentic artistry of the Baluch people. The foundation is built from durable wool, likely sourced from the highland flocks around Ghazni province, known for producing some of Afghanistan's finest wool. Each knot was tied by hand using natural dyes that will age gracefully, ensuring this piece maintains its character for decades to come.
